When planning a trip to Mexico, choosing the right time to visit is crucial to ensure an enjoyable experience. Mexico boasts diverse climates across its regions, so the best time to visit can vary depending on your destination and preferences.

Climate Overview

  • Mexico generally has two main seasons: dry season and rainy season.
  • Dry season typically runs from November to April, offering pleasant weather with minimal rainfall.
  • Rainy season, characterized by more frequent rain showers, occurs from May to October.

Peak Tourist Season

  • The most popular time to visit Mexico is during the winter months of December to February.
  • Peak tourist season brings larger crowds and higher prices, especially in tourist hotspots like Cancun and Mexico City.

Best Time for Beach Destinations

  • Beach destinations, such as Cancun, Puerto Vallarta, and Los Cabos, are best visited during the dry season for sunny days and warm temperatures.
  • January to April is an ideal time for a beach holiday in Mexico, offering perfect beach weather.

Best Time for Cultural Exploration

  • For cultural exploration and sightseeing, consider visiting Mexico during the shoulder seasons of spring (April to June) and fall (September to October).
  • Milder temperatures and fewer crowds make it easier to explore historical sites and immerse yourself in local culture.

Top Attractions in Mexico

Mexico is a diverse country with a rich cultural heritage and natural beauty, offering visitors a wide range of attractions to explore. Whether you're interested in history, nature, or simply relaxing on a beautiful beach, Mexico has something for everyone.

Historical Sites:

  • Chichen Itza: Explore the impressive ruins of this ancient Mayan city, including the iconic Kukulkan Pyramid.
  • Teotihuacan: Discover the massive pyramids of the Sun and the Moon near Mexico City, remnants of a once-powerful civilization.

Natural Wonders:

  • Cenotes: Swim in these unique natural sinkholes found throughout the Yucatan Peninsula.
  • Copper Canyon: Marvel at this vast canyon system in the northern state of Chihuahua, larger and deeper than the Grand Canyon.

Beach Destinations:

  • Cancun: Relax on the pristine white sands and crystal-clear waters of this popular resort city in the Yucatan Peninsula.
  • Tulum: Visit the picturesque ruins overlooking the Caribbean Sea or sunbathe on the beautiful beaches.

Cultural Highlights:

  • Mexico City: Immerse yourself in the vibrant art scene, historic architecture, and delicious cuisine of the country's bustling capital.
  • Oaxaca: Sample traditional foods, visit artisan markets, and admire the colorful colonial architecture in this charming city.

Outdoor Adventures:

  • Whale Watching in Baja California: Witness the majestic gray whales on their annual migration along the Pacific coast.
  • Sumidero Canyon: Take a boat tour through this stunning canyon in Chiapas, home to diverse wildlife and towering cliffs.

Cuisine of Mexico

Mexico is known for its vibrant and diverse cuisine, which has been shaped by a rich history of indigenous cultures, Spanish colonization, and global influences. From flavorful tacos to spicy salsas, Mexican food offers a tantalizing array of tastes and textures that cater to every palate.

Key Features of Mexican Cuisine:
- Corn: Corn is a staple ingredient in Mexican cuisine, used to make tortillas, tamales, and other traditional dishes.
- Chilies: Mexican food is famous for its spicy kick, with a wide variety of chilies like jalapeños and habaneros adding heat to dishes.
- Beans: Beans are a common protein source in Mexican cuisine, often served as refried beans or in stews.
- Avocado: Avocado, in the form of guacamole or sliced on dishes, is a popular ingredient in Mexican cooking.

Regional Specialties:
- Oaxaca: Known for its rich moles and string cheese, Oaxacan cuisine is celebrated for its complex flavors.
- Yucatán: Yucatecan cuisine features a unique blend of Mayan and Caribbean influences, with dishes like cochinita pibil (slow-roasted pork) and papadzules (egg-stuffed tortillas).

Popular Mexican Dishes:
- Tacos: A beloved Mexican street food, tacos come in endless varieties, from carne asada to al pastor.
- Mole: Mole is a flavorful sauce made with chilies, chocolate, and spices, often served over chicken or enchiladas.
- Chilaquiles: This traditional breakfast dish features fried tortillas tossed in salsa and topped with eggs and cheese.

Dining Etiquette:
- In Mexico, it is customary to greet restaurant staff with a friendly Buen provecho before beginning your meal.
- Mexicans often enjoy long, leisurely meals with family and friends, savoring each bite and engaging in lively conversation.

Traveling Around Mexico

Traveling around Mexico is an exciting experience, offering a diverse range of transportation options for visitors to explore the country. From bustling cities to serene beaches, Mexico has something for everyone. Here are some key points to keep in mind when navigating Mexico:

  • Public Transportation: Mexico has an extensive public transportation system that includes buses, metro systems, and taxis. The metro system in Mexico City is one of the largest and busiest in the world.

  • Rental Cars: Renting a car in Mexico is a popular option for travelers looking to explore off-the-beaten-path locations. It is recommended to choose reputable car rental companies and purchase full insurance coverage.

  • Uber and Ridesharing: Uber and other ridesharing services operate in major cities in Mexico, providing a convenient and safe way to get around. They are often more affordable than traditional taxis.

  • Domestic Flights: Traveling long distances within Mexico can be time-consuming by bus or car. Domestic flights are a fast and efficient way to travel between cities.

  • Safety Considerations: While traveling in Mexico, it is important to remain vigilant and be aware of your surroundings. Exercise caution, especially in crowded areas and at night.

  • Language: Spanish is the official language of Mexico. Learning basic Spanish phrases can greatly enhance your travel experience.

  • Currency: The official currency of Mexico is the Mexican Peso. It is recommended to exchange currency at official exchange houses or use ATMs to withdraw pesos.

  • Cultural Sensitivity: Mexico is known for its rich cultural heritage. Respect local customs and traditions, and dress modestly when visiting religious sites.

Exploring Mexico's Culture

Mexico's rich and vibrant culture is a tapestry woven from the diverse threads of its indigenous heritage and Spanish influence. Music and dancing are integral parts of Mexican culture, with mariachi bands and folkloric dances showcasing the country's rhythm and tradition.

Traditional Mexican cuisine is world-renowned for its bold flavors and unique ingredients. From savory tacos to spicy mole, every dish tells a story of Mexico's history and regional diversity. Street food stalls offer a taste of authentic Mexican flavors, while high-end restaurants provide a modern twist on classic recipes.

Art is deeply ingrained in Mexican culture, with renowned artists like Diego Rivera and Frida Kahlo shaping the country's artistic landscape. The vibrant colors and intricate designs of Mexican folk art, such as pottery and textiles, reflect the creativity and craftsmanship of its people.

Religion plays a significant role in Mexican culture, with Catholicism being the dominant faith. Religious festivals like Dia de los Muertos (Day of the Dead) offer a glimpse into the spiritual beliefs and customs of the Mexican people.

Mexico's cultural calendar is filled with festivals and celebrations that highlight the country's diverse traditions and folklore. From the lively Carnival in Veracruz to the mystical rituals of the Mayan communities, each event showcases a unique aspect of Mexican culture.

Health and Safety Recommendations

When traveling to Mexico, prioritizing health and safety is essential to ensure a smooth and enjoyable trip. Here are some key recommendations to keep in mind:

Vaccinations and Health Precautions

  • Check with a healthcare provider well in advance to determine if any vaccinations are necessary.
  • Consider travel insurance to cover any unexpected medical expenses during the trip.

Food and Water Safety

  • Stick to bottled water and avoid drinking tap water, including ice cubes in drinks.
  • Eat at reputable establishments to minimize the risk of foodborne illnesses.

Sun Protection and Hydration

  • Use sunscreen with a high SPF, especially during peak hours of sun exposure.
  •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day.

Crime Awareness

  • Remain vigilant of your surroundings and be cautious of petty theft in tourist areas.
  • Avoid flashing valuable belongings to reduce the chances of becoming a target.

Emergency Preparedness

  • Carry identification and keep important contact numbers handy in case of emergencies.
  • Familiarize yourself with the nearest embassy or consulate location for your country.

Transportation Safety

  • Opt for reputable transportation services to ensure a safe journey to your destinations.
  • Use marked taxis or rideshare apps for added security during travels within Mexico.
